Transaction 00d80228a42789582171f4d81ce47953e95d2285672aa74ae50ffae14b052880

6 Input
2 Outputs
  • 00d80228a42789582171f4d81ce47953e95d2285672aa74ae50ffae14b052880:0
  • value  33000000
    address  1HTKFFXK2zbkxpGvxD2LxYHQMGtYDydP2H
  • 00d80228a42789582171f4d81ce47953e95d2285672aa74ae50ffae14b052880:1
  • value  994073
    address  3QSPsauy8CsTuxi6xKCRbKFzW2Nhxjx8YJ